Christmas Porridge (Julgrot)

Christmas rice porridge is a part of the traditional Swedish Christmas Eve supper. According to tradition and practiced in many homes both in Sweden and America each person must compose and recite a rhyme before touching the porridge and the one who gets the almond hidden in the porridge will marry during the coming year.

Yield: 8 servings

Ingredients

  • 1 cup rice
  • 2 quarts boiling water
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 5 cups milk
  • 1 blanched whole almond
  • Cinnamon or grated almonds
  • Granulated sugar
  • Cold milk

Instructions

  1. Add washed and drained rice to boiling water. Again bring to a boil and cook, uncovered, 1 minute.
  2. Drain rice thoroughly; add butter.
  3. Add rice, salt and sugar to milk in top of double boiler. Cover and cook over gently boiling water until rice is tender and milk is absorbed, about 2 hours.
  4. Pour into serving dish and stir in almond.
  5. Sprinkle top generously with cinnamon and sugar or grated almonds and sugar.
  6. Serve with cold milk.
